活动介绍
file-type

"Clickhouse 学习笔记:特点、安装、数据类型、表引擎"

DOCX文件

5星 · 超过95%的资源 | 下载需积分: 25 | 10.17MB | 更新于2023-12-19 | 97 浏览量 | 10 评论 | 8 下载量 举报 收藏
download 立即下载
ClickHouse 学习笔记是关于学习 ClickHouse 各种特性、功能和性能优化的总结和心得。ClickHouse 是一个开源的列式存储数据库管理系统(DBMS),适用于大规模数据分析和实时查询。本文将围绕 ClickHouse 的入门、安装、数据类型、表引擎等方面展开讨论。 在入门部分,首先介绍了 ClickHouse 的特点,包括列式存储、功能覆盖标准 SQL 大部分语法、多样化引擎等。列式存储使得 ClickHouse 更适合于聚合查询,而其多样化的引擎类似于 MySQL 的 InnoDB 和 MyISAM,让用户可以根据不同的需求选择合适的引擎。同时,ClickHouse 还拥有高吞吐写入能力,数据分区和线程级并行等特性,但同时也需要注意单表查询会吃掉所有 CPU 资源,需要避免 Join 操作以提高查询性能。 在安装部分,介绍了 ClickHouse 的准备工作,同时提示了一些需要注意的版本支持和功能变化,以及与 MySQL 同步的方法。 在数据类型部分,详细介绍了 ClickHouse 支持的各种数据类型,包括整型、浮点型、布尔型、Decimal 型、时间类型和数组。同时也强调了尽量避免使用 Nullable 类型以提高性能。 在表引擎部分,介绍了 ClickHouse 的常用表引擎,包括使用方法和注意事项。对于 TinyLog、Memory 和 MergeTree 引擎分别进行了详细介绍,包括主键唯一性、partition by 和 primary key 的可选性,以及稀疏索引的使用和排序等。 在本文中,旨在通过对 ClickHouse 的入门、安装、数据类型和表引擎等方面的讨论,帮助读者更加深入地了解 ClickHouse 的特性和功能,从而更好地利用 ClickHouse 进行数据分析和查询。希望本文能够为 ClickHouse 的学习和使用提供一定的帮助,同时也希望读者在实际使用中能够根据自己的需求进行更深入的学习和实践。

相关推荐

资源评论
用户头像
郭逗
2025.06.06
适合初学者的ClickHouse入门指南,内容实用。
用户头像
以墨健康道
2025.05.07
结合实例,学习笔记让复杂概念变得易懂。
用户头像
图像车间
2025.04.03
笔记内容全面,覆盖了ClickHouse的基础与实践。
用户头像
巧笑倩兮Evelina
2025.03.30
从基础到进阶,ClickHouse学习笔记循序渐进。
用户头像
蟹蛛
2025.02.23
实用性强,是学习ClickHouse不可多得的优质资源。😌
用户头像
天眼妹
2025.02.21
深入浅出,ClickHouse学习资料详尽丰富。
用户头像
XU美伢
2025.02.19
文档结构清晰,让初学者能够一步步深入理解ClickHouse。
用户头像
开眼旅行精选
2025.02.15
适合想要快速掌握ClickHouse技术的学习者。
用户头像
那你干哈
2025.01.12
对于想要系统学习ClickHouse的人来说,这份笔记很值得参考。
用户头像
明儿去打球
2024.12.26
对于数据仓库感兴趣的读者,这份笔记不容错过。
you来有去
  • 粉丝: 8601
上传资源 快速赚钱